CILANTRO LIME SALSA



Cilantro Lime Salsa image

Cilantro lime salsa is loaded with ripe Roma tomatoes, red onions, garlic, fresh cilantro, lime juice, and a secret ingredient that takes this salsa to the next level! Enjoy this vibrant and zesty salsa with tortilla chips, in burritos, or on top of enchiladas!

Provided by Stacey Eckert

Categories     Appetizer

Time 40m

Number Of Ingredients 10

8 Roma tomatoes (stems removed)
1 small orange bell pepper (seeds, membranes, and stem removed)
1 small yellow bell pepper (seeds, membranes, and stem removed)
1/2 medium red onion
2 medium garlic cloves (minced)
1 cup fresh cilantro
2 tbsp lime juice ((add more to taste))
1 tsp cumin
1/4 tsp smoked paprika
1/4 tsp himalayan pink sea salt ((add more to taste))

Steps:

  • Roughly chop the tomatoes, bell peppers, red onion, and fresh cilantro. Mince the garlic cloves. Make sure to remove the seeds, membranes, and stem from the bell peppers and cut off the tomato stems. Add it all to a large food processor cup.
  • Add 2 tbsp of fresh lime juice, 1 tsp ground cumin, 1/4 tsp smoked paprika, and 1/4 tsp sea salt to the food processor. Put the lid on and pulse it a few times or until you are happy with the consistency of the salsa.
  • Taste the salsa and add more lime juice and salt if it's needed. Put the salsa in an airtight container and store in the fridge for 30 minutes to chill prior to serving.

CILANTRO-AND-MINT SALAD



Cilantro-and-Mint Salad image

It's not just cilantro-and-mint salad, of course. There is parsley as well, and also arugula and baby lettuce: a jumble of herbs and soft greens lightly dressed with lime juice and oil. It's a terrific salad to serve as a foil to spicy food, or to sprinkle on a taco as kind of green-ish version of pico de gallo.

Provided by Sam Sifton

Categories     salads and dressings, side dish

Time 15m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 cups cilantro leaves
1 cup flat-leaf parsley leaves
1 cup mint leaves
1 cup arugula leaves
2 cups mâche or other soft lettuce leaves
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/2 teaspoon red-pepper flakes
3 tablespoons lime juice, or to taste
2 tablespoons olive oil, or to taste

Steps:

  • Wash the herbs and greens. Fill a large bowl or clean sink with cold water, and add the leaves. Swish them around to loosen dirt, then gently lift out and dry in a salad spinner or on clean kitchen towels. (You can do this up to a day ahead, refrigerating the dry leaves in sealed plastic bags or containers with a paper towel to absorb excess water.)
  • When ready to serve, whisk together the salt, pepper, red-pepper flakes, lime juice and olive oil in a small bowl, then check the seasonings. Put the leaves in a large bowl, drizzle the dressing over them and toss gently to coat. Serve immediately.

CILANTRO SALSA WITH MINT



Cilantro Salsa With Mint image

Provided by Karen Baar

Categories     condiments, dips and spreads

Time 15m

Yield 2/3 cup (6 servings)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 large bunch cilantro, stems removed
1 jalapeno, seeded
1/2 cup basil leaves
1/4 cup mint leaves
2 garlic cloves
1/2 cup plus 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
Juice of 1 or 2 limes, to taste
Salt to taste

Steps:

  • Finely chop cilantro, jalapeno, basil, mint and garlic. Mix.
  • Stir in oil, lime juice, salt and 1/4 cup water. Adjust salt and lime juice to taste. Use as a sauce for grilled fish or vegetables, or on tomatoes.

CILANTRO SALSA



Cilantro Salsa image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     appetizer

Time 10m

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 large bunch cilantro
2 garlic cloves
1/2 cup olive oil
3 teaspoons lime juice
1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1/2 teaspoon ground coriander
Salt, to taste

Steps:

  • For a thicker sauce, chop cilantro and garlic and place in a blender. Puree with 1/4 cup water and the oil. Add lime juice, cayenne pepper, coriander and salt.
  • For a thinner sauce, chop cilantro and garlic very finely. Then stir in 1/4 cup water, oil, lime juice, cayenne pepper, coriander and salt.
  • The emulsified version can be served as a dip with pita bread. Serve the thinner version with fried halloumi or other fried cheese, vegetable fritters or with a salad.
